WebNov 18, 2013 · Human pluripotent stem cells (hPSCs), including human embryonic stem cells (hESCs) (1) and induced pluripotent stem cells (iPSCs) (2), have the capacities for indefinite in vitro expansion and differentiation into all cell types within adults (3). WebACS-7010 ™. iPSC-derived Mesenchymal Stem Cells; BYS0112 are induced pluripotent stem cells that have been differentiated into multipotent stromal cells. iPSC-derived MSCs may be further differentiated into osteoblasts, chondrocytes, myocytes, and adipocytes. These cells can be used in bone cell lineage differentiation, regenerative medicine ... WebNov 8, 2024 · Methods: Human iPS cells were cultured in a serum-free medium containing the transforming growth factor-β pathway inhibitor SB431542 for the differentiation to MSC in vitro. These iPS-MSCs were expanded to form cell patches (10 6 cells/sheet). These iPS-MSC patches were mechanically fragmented and were then administered into HLI mice as … WebDifferentiation. WebMar 15, 2024 · The robust method of MSC derivation from ESCs and iPSCs provides an efficient approach to rapidly generate sufficient MSCs for in vitro disease modeling and clinical applications. ... They exhibited a high tri-lineage differentiation potential with over 90% transcriptional similarity to the primary MSCs derived from bone marrow.
